How Has West Africa Visual Art Influenced Modern Art and Culture?

Art|Modern Art

West African visual art has had a far-reaching influence on modern art and culture. This influence can be seen in the works of some of the world’s most famous artists, such as Pablo Picasso and Wassily Kandinsky.

West African visual art has also inspired many other forms of artistic expression, such as fashion, design, and music. It is clear that West African visual art has had a profound impact on modern art and culture.

West African visual art is characterized by bold colors, vibrant patterns, and an emphasis on symbolism. These elements have been used to express a wide range of emotions, from joy to sorrow.

The use of vivid colors and intricate designs are often used to create a sense of movement or energy in the artwork. West African visual art often includes figures that are part human, part animal or otherworldly creatures.

West African visual art has been around for centuries, with some estimates dating it back to 2000 BC. Over time, the artwork has evolved to reflect changing cultures and eras. This evolution has resulted in a variety of styles ranging from traditional tribal masks to more contemporary abstract works.

The influence of West African visual art can be seen in modern works by many renowned artists. Pablo Picasso was known for incorporating elements from African masks into his Cubist paintings.

Wassily Kandinsky was inspired by the vivid colors he saw in West African artwork when creating his abstract paintings. In addition, fashion designers such as Yves Saint Laurent have been heavily influenced by West African visuals when creating their collections.

West African visual art has also had an impact on popular music genres such as hip hop culture. Artists like Kanye West have used visuals inspired by traditional West African masks in their music videos and album covers. This connection between music and visuals is credited with helping to create an iconic look for hip hop culture.
